Course Content

• Understanding Trauma: Types, Impacts, and Responses
• Trauma-Informed Care Principles and Practices
• Advanced Assessment and Intervention Strategies for Trauma Survivors
• Working with Complex Trauma and Comorbid Disorders
• Ethical Considerations in Trauma Support Practices
• Crisis Intervention and Stabilization Techniques
• Self-Care and Secondary Trauma Prevention for Professionals
• Trauma-Specific Therapeutic Modalities (e.g., EMDR, CBT)
• Case Management and Advocacy for Trauma Survivors
• Trauma Support Groups: Facilitation and Co-facilitation

Career path

Career Role Description
Trauma Support Practitioner (Primary: Trauma, Secondary: Support) Provides direct support to individuals experiencing trauma, utilizing evidence-based therapeutic interventions. High demand in mental health services.
Trauma-Informed Social Worker (Primary: Trauma, Secondary: Social Work) Applies trauma-informed principles in social work practice, focusing on building resilience and fostering safety. Crucial role in child protection and community services.
Trauma Specialist Counsellor (Primary: Trauma, Secondary: Counselling) Specializes in trauma-focused therapies, offering individual and group counselling to address the impacts of traumatic events. Growing need in private practice and NHS settings.
Trauma-Focused Psychotherapist (Primary: Trauma, Secondary: Psychotherapy) Provides advanced psychotherapy to individuals with complex trauma histories, integrating various therapeutic modalities. Significant expertise and experience required.
